The Reflector accepts letters to the editor, commentaries and columns from members of the University of Indianapolis community. Submissions may be subject to editing for grammar and spelling. The indicator (sic) may appear after the error.
To be considered for publication, letters to the editor must include a valid name and telephone number, which will be verified. Letters are subject to condensation and editing to remove profanity. Submission of a letter gives The Reflector permission to publish it in print and/or online.
All correspondence should be addressed to The Reflector, Esch Hall, Room 333 or sent via email to reflector@uindy.edu.
